Estates Development Manager
Outskirts of Crawley
Salary & benefits: £52,000 – £56,000 (DOE) + Company Car / Car Allowance + 25 Days Holiday + Bank Holidays
Lloyd Recruitment Services are pleased to be working with a large organisation seeking an Estates Development Manager to join their team. This is an excellent opportunity to manage a diverse portfolio of commercial construction projects across a national estate.
You will oversee multiple projects simultaneously across greenfield, brownfield, refurbishment, including Areas of Outstanding Natural Beauty.
Estates Development Manager Key Responsibilities
- Manage construction projects from inception through to completion and defects stage
- Oversee design, specification, and procurement of major works projects
- Ensure compliance with CDM Regulations, Building Regulations, and health & safety legislation
- Act as Contract Administrator (JCT), including site visits and progress monitoring
- Prepare cost estimates and capital expenditure reports for senior stakeholders
- Lead project meetings and contribute to design development
- Support planning applications and building regulations approvals
- Maintain project documentation and standard specifications
- Review drawings from concept through to as-built using AutoCAD
- Monitor project progress using project management systems
- Provide technical advice on site development and potential new opportunities
- Manage multiple projects simultaneously across a varied estate portfolio
Estates Development Manager Essential Skills & Experience
- Minimum 2 years’ experience in construction project management
- Experience administering JCT contracts
- Good knowledge of Building Regulations, CDM, and health & safety legislation
- CSCS card holder; SMSTS desirable (training can be provided)
- Full UK driving licence and willingness to travel nationwide, including overnight stays
- Experience working across greenfield, brownfield, or environmentally sensitive sites
- Proficient in AutoCAD
- Strong organisational skills with the ability to manage multiple projects
- Excellent communication and report writing skills
- Confident working with internal teams and external consultants
- Strong IT skills (Microsoft Office and Google Workspace)
Desirable
- Degree or HND in a relevant discipline
- Membership of CIOB
